Special welding electrode for stainless and heat-resistant steels

AMA 1474JB7

AWS/ASME SFA – 5.4: ~ E 309 L–17
Comparable No.of material: 1.4332
DIN 8556: E 23 12 L R 23
prEN 1600: E 23 12 L R 12

Application/properties:

Electrode for joining of dissimilar steels, (austenitic steels to ferritic steels) and for depositing claddings austenitic. Weld metal consists of with approximately 15% delta-ferrite. Claddings on alloyed or low-alloyed steel are already corrosion resistant in the first layer. Highest operating temperature for dissimilar steel joints is +300°C; at higher temperature 1604G electrode shall be used. fine droplet metal transfer, good wash-in of joint sides, finely-rippled bead surface, easily removable slag. Easy arc striking and restriking.
